Michael Dunlop, the legendary “Man of Man Tote Ace,” made a triumphant return to Northern Ireland’s Tandragee 100 Road Race by securing a victory in the 1000cc race. The County Armagh event, which last took place in 2022, made a comeback this year following extensive resurfacing of the racecourse roads.

Since the last Tandragee 100, Michael Dunlop has etched his name into racing history, becoming the most successful rider ever at the Isle of Man TT. In 2024, he surpassed the late Joey Dunlop’s record, achieving 26 TT wins. Recently, he further extended his record to 33 wins after claiming four more victories at this year’s TT.

Dunlop has enjoyed a remarkably successful season so far, with wins not only at the TT but also at the North West 200 and Cookstown 100. After a hiatus from Tandragee since 2013, Dunlop celebrated his return on Saturday by winning a five-lap open race. Riding an MD Racing BMW in the Superstock class, he narrowly edged out Michael Sweeney by just 0.4 seconds, overtaking Sweeney who had led earlier.

Dunlop then claimed a second victory in a Superbike feature race at the day’s end, again besting Sweeney by 8.059 seconds over six laps, showcasing his dominance on his BMW. Sean Anderson finished third, having previously won the classic superbike race on a Norton, followed by Manxman Connor Cummins. Anderson also secured a podium spot in the open race earlier on Saturday by outpacing Mike Brown, who took fourth place.

Brown, however, triumphed in the Supersport class, winning both Friday evening and Saturday races. On Saturday, he beat Dunlop by 3.545 seconds, with Dunlop facing challenges after a qualifying issue on his Ducati V2 Panigale, starting 17th on the grid. Despite this, Dunlop set a new lap record in his class and fought hard to reach the podium in the revised race.

Looking ahead, Michael Dunlop is set to compete next month at the Southern 100 Isle of Man, where he will face off against fellow TT stars Dean Harrison and Davy Todd.
